Why Local Knowledge Helps with Wall Placement
Shopping with local expertise can make it easier to choose artwork that suits your environment and layout. If you’re based on the, having a retailer familiar with common home styles, lighting conditions, and interior trends can improve your results. For example, artworks with higher contrast tend to stand out in brighter spaces, while softer palettes can complement rooms with warm undertones. The right service should also guide you toward practical decisions—like measuring your wall area, choosing landscape versus portrait orientation, and selecting complementary pieces that work together across a hallway or open-plan living space.
